NAC delivers one De Havilland Dash 8-400 on lease to Link PNG

Nordic Aviation Capital (NAC) has confirmed it has delivered one De Havilland Dash 8-400, MSN 4184, to Link PNG on lease. The aircraft was originally scheduled to deliver in 2019, however, due to the impact of COVID-19 on travel restrictions the delivery was postponed. SAS to phase out 21 older, less fuel-efficient aircraft

SAS has initiated the process to phase out 21 of its older and less fuel-efficient aircraft at an earlier stage than originally planned, including 15 Boeing 737NG, five Airbus A340 and one Airbus A330 aircraft.
